Underwater welding is a unique welding process where a professional diver who is also a welder goes into the water and applies the same tactics used in a traditional ground welding method over submerged structures and workpieces.

To become an underwater welder, start by getting certified as a topside welder through an accredited welding school and work for a few years welding topside to gain experience. Next, enroll in a commercial diving academy and become a certified commercial diver. Then, attend an underwater welding school to combine your welding and diving skills. Also called hyperbaric welding, underwater welding was invented in the early 1930s and is still used for maintaining and repairing fully or partially submerged marine structures. Inland hyperbaric welders can work on small seacraft, dams and bridges. As the name suggests the welding work carried out underwater is called underwater welding.

Underwater welding Hyperbaric welding is the process of welding at elevated pressures, normally underwater. Hyperbaric welding can either take place wet in the water itself or dry inside a specially constructed positive pressure enclosure and hence a dry environment.

According to commercial divers and global statistics, the average welding underwater salary is $53,990 annually and $25.96 per hour. However, most incomes float around $25,000 – $80,000. Wet underwater welding directly exposes the diver and electrode to the water and surrounding elements. Divers usually use around 300–400 amps of direct current to power their electrode, and they weld using varied forms of arc welding.

2018-06-21 2013-10-16 Underwater welding methods. Commercial welders use two methods to weld underwater : wet welding and dry welding (also called hyperbaric welding). Wet welding. In wet welding, the welder directly fixes the workpiece in water using a welding rod different to standard surface welding. Offshore underwater welding can mean working on ships, for example, you may be tasked with repairing underwater pipelines or subsea installations.

Underwater welding is used for ships for temporary or permanent repairs of cracks in the hull of the ship, for the installation of anodic protection, for temporary repair of cracks on rudder and rudder blades.
